Solution for What is 231 increased by 100 percent? (231 plus 100%):

231 + (100/100 * 231) = 462

Now we have: 231 increased by 100 percent = 462

Question: What is 231 increased by 100 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 231.

Step 2: We have b with value of 100.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 231 + (\frac{100}{100} * 231).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{462}

Therefore, {231} increased by {100\%} is {462}
